Plaintiff and respondent Clara Vivian Stamm originally brought this action in ejectment against the defendant and appellant B. E. Colvin. By cross-complaint said defendant and appellant sought to compel specific performance by plaintiff of a contract between defendant and one Colin N. Clinch. Colin N. Clinch was, on May 11, 1924, the owner of the premises in controversy, and both plaintiff and defendant derive their respective titles, if any they have, through said Clinch.
On May 11, 1924, Colin N. Clinch made and executed a written offer to exchange properties, which said offer was in words as follows:
“Los Angeles, California, May 11, 1924. “Mr. J. K. Delozier,
“515 Hill-street Bldg.,
“Los Angeles, California.
“Dear Sir:
“I will deed lot 1, Tract 5155 to B. E. Colvin subject to encumbrance and liens of record, and agree to pay off same down to $8,000.00; also to pay interest on all encumbrance, until it is reduced to the $8,000. And let Colvin take immediate possession of said property. Providing B. E. Colvin, will deed to me or my assigns, Lot 5, of Ivareen Terrace Tract,
abd
extend note of $8,000, and return same when encumbrance on Lót 1 is reduced to the $8,000.
“The $8,000, on Lot 1, of Tract 5155, is not to become due within two and a half years and the interest rate not to exceed 7%.
“Yours very truly,
“O. L. Clinch.”
Colvin at the time of making said offer was in Willows. The said J. G. Delozier to whom said offer was addressed, was at said time a partner of said Colvin, and lived in Los Angeles. Prior to the making of said written offer Clinch and Colvin had discussed the making of such a trade, and Clinch took Colvin to see the property in controversy.
